[QUOTE="Krystal, post: 3266936, member: 37301"] Hrm, let's see, how did I get started? Back around 1995 I was bored and wanted a book to read and we were in a WalMarts. My mom pointed out a book with a dragon on it and said "You like fantasy, try that." And I said "No... that looks too much like all of Anne McCaffrey's dragon books and I can't stand them." Well, my mother convinced me to buy it anyway, since if I liked it great, and if not, it was only a couple of bucks. So I did. It was Jean Rabe's "Dawning of a New Age" (I think that was the first in the trilogy...) So I read it, enjoyed it, and started looking for other DragonLance books and read the Autumn/Winter/Spring Trilogy. I don't remember which book it was, the first or the ones after, but I was looking through the covers and saw a website address for wizards. Being fairly new to the web, I was curious and checked it out. I stumbled onto ISRP as I saw a link to online chat rooms. I'd been in chat rooms on yahoo and was curious what this one was like, so I made a name and started poking around. This was back in the days of TSROs instead of WIZOs. The rooms were much quieter and had fewer people back then. I managed to stumble on a friendly TSRO, who I never saw again (I wonder if he was impersonating them, as I remember there being a notice about turning in people who were impersonating TSROs) and a couple of friendly folks. I made friends with many of them, some who I'm still friends with and some who, unfortunately, I don't know if I could say if I am or aren't. *shrugs* Krystal was my first and pretty much ONLY character I've ever had. I tried making other characters, but I never seemed to hit it off with any of them like I did Krys. [/QUOTE]
